[hibernate-commits] Hibernate SVN: r11287 - bran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ec.

hibernate-commits at lists.jboss.org hibernate-commits at lists.jboss.org
Thu Mar 15 07:38:25 EDT 2007


Author: steve.ebersole at jboss.com
Date: 2007-03-15 07:38:25 -0400 (Thu, 15 Mar 2007)
New Revision: 11287

Modified:
   bran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/AbstractStatementExecutor.java
   bran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/MultiTableDeleteExecutor.java
   bran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/MultiTableUpdateExecutor.java
Log:
HHH-2489 : hql + sql-comments

Modified: bran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/AbstractStatementExecutor.java
===================================================================
--- bran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/AbstractStatementExecutor.java	2007-03-15 10:33:16 UTC (rev 11286)
+++ bran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/AbstractStatementExecutor.java	2007-03-15 11:38:25 UTC (rev 11287)
@@ -92,7 +92,7 @@
 		select.setWhereClause( whereJoinFragment + userWhereClause );
 
 		InsertSelect insert = new InsertSelect( getFactory().getDialect() );
-		if ( getFactory().getSettings().isCommentsEnabled() && getFactory().getDialect().supportsCommentOn() ) {
+		if ( getFactory().getSettings().isCommentsEnabled() ) {
 			insert.setComment( "insert-select for " + persister.getEntityName() + " ids" );
 		}
 		insert.setTableName( persister.getTemporaryIdTableName() );

Modified: bran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/MultiTableDeleteExecutor.java
===================================================================
--- bran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/MultiTableDeleteExecutor.java	2007-03-15 10:33:16 UTC (rev 11286)
+++ bran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/MultiTableDeleteExecutor.java	2007-03-15 11:38:25 UTC (rev 11287)
@@ -60,7 +60,7 @@
 			final Delete delete = new Delete()
 					.setTableName( tableNames[i] )
 					.setWhere( "(" + StringHelper.join( ", ", columnNames[i] ) + ") IN (" + idSubselect + ")" );
-			if ( getFactory().getSettings().isCommentsEnabled() && getFactory().getDialect().supportsCommentOn() ) {
+			if ( getFactory().getSettings().isCommentsEnabled() ) {
 				delete.setComment( "bulk delete" );
 			}
 

Modified: bran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/MultiTableUpdateExecutor.java
===================================================================
--- bran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/MultiTableUpdateExecutor.java	2007-03-15 10:33:16 UTC (rev 11286)
+++ branches/Branch_3_2/Hibernate3/src/org/hibernate/hql/ast/exec/MultiTableUpdateExecutor.java	2007-03-15 11:38:25 UTC (rev 11287)
@@ -65,7 +65,7 @@
 			Update update = new Update( getFactory().getDialect() )
 					.setTableName( tableNames[tableIndex] )
 					.setWhere( "(" + StringHelper.join( ", ", columnNames[tableIndex] ) + ") IN (" + idSubselect + ")" );
-			if ( getFactory().getSettings().isCommentsEnabled() && getFactory().getDialect().supportsCommentOn() ) {
+			if ( getFactory().getSettings().isCommentsEnabled() ) {
 				update.setComment( "bulk update" );
 			}
 			final Iterator itr = assignmentSpecifications.iterator();




More information about the hibernate-commits mailing list